What is SLANG Worldwide Institutional Ownership?

Institutional ownership is the percentage of shares that are owned by institutions out of the total shares outstanding. As of today, SLANG Worldwide's institutional ownership is 0.11%.

Insider Ownership is the percentage of shares that are owned by company insiders relative to the total shares outstanding. As of today, SLANG Worldwide's Insider Ownership is 0.00%.

Float Percentage Of Total Shares Outstanding is the percentage of float shares relative to the total shares outstanding. As of today, SLANG Worldwide's Float Percentage Of Total Shares Outstanding is 0.00%.

SLANG Worldwide Inc is a cannabis-focused consumer packaged goods company. It is focused on acquiring and developing regional brands, as well as creating new brands to meet the needs of cannabis consumers. It operates in two reportable segments Core Markets, and Emerging Markets, and the majority of its revenue comes from the Core Market. Geographically it operates in Canada and the U.S. It derives the majority of its revenue from the U.S. Its brand portfolio involves, Firefly, O.pen, and Alchemy Naturals.
